TDA Care Solutions is seeking a Registered Manager or Deputy Manager to lead a solo EBD children's home in Macclesfield. This role offers a competitive salary, signing bonus, and Ofsted performance bonus, focusing on quality care for one young person.

Ideal candidates will have strong EBD experience and leadership capabilities. The position provides growth opportunities within a stable environment. Interviews are happening this week, so apply now to be part of a dedicated team with therapeutic support.
